Taxonomic Classification

Rank Beautiful Sunbird Black Jackrabbit
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Aves (Birds)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Passeriformes (Songbirds)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ares)
Family Nectariniidae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ares)
Genus Cinnyris Lepus
Species Cinnyris pulchellus Lepus insularis

Evolutionary Relationship

Beautiful Sunbird and Black Jackrabbit share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
